Standard ATX units remain the dominant category, accounting for approximately 65% of the market share due to their widespread compatibility with mainstream desktop PCs and enterprise systems. Modular power supplies are gaining traction, driven by the increasing demand for efficient cable management and enhanced airflow within high-performance gaming and workstation setups. SFX power supplies, designed for compact systems, constitute a smaller but rapidly growing segment, particularly within mini-ITX and small form factor (SFF) PC markets. The market size for ATX power supplies in South Korea is estimated at around USD 1.2 billion in 2023, with Standard ATX units comprising roughly USD 780 million, Modular units around USD 330 million, and SFX units approximately USD 90 million. The market is currently in a growth stage characterized by technological innovation and evolving consumer preferences. Modular power supplies are experiencing the highest growth rate, estimated at a CAGR of 8-10% over the next five years, driven by increasing adoption in gaming, professional content creation, and high-performance computing sectors. Standard ATX power supplies are relatively mature but continue to benefit from incremental innovations such as higher efficiency ratings (80 Plus Gold/Platinum) and smart power management features. SFX units, while niche, are witnessing rapid growth due to the rising popularity of compact gaming PCs and home office setups. Technological Disruption & Innovation in South Korea ATX Computer Power Supplies Market Innovation is a core driver transforming the South Korea ATX power supplies landscape. The integration of smart, IoT-enabled power units allows real-time monitoring and adaptive power management, enhancing efficiency and lifespan. Modular power supplies are increasingly adopted, providing flexibility for custom builds and upgrades, reducing waste, and improving airflow within systems. Emerging trends include the development of ultra-efficient power supplies with 80 PLUS Titanium certification, which significantly reduces energy consumption. The adoption of gallium nitride (GaN) semiconductors is revolutionizing power supply design, enabling smaller, more efficient units with higher wattage capabilities. Additionally, manufacturers are investing heavily in R&D to develop eco-friendly, recyclable materials, aligning with global sustainability goals. These technological disruptions are creating new standards for reliability, efficiency, and environmental responsibility in South Korea’s power supply industry.
